Transaction 8891813e862b807207142562605cfb596094d83ebce82f7e64a957f357159648
1 Input
1 Output
-
8891813e862b807207142562605cfb596094d83ebce82f7e64a957f357159648:0
- value
- 439759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fcda35146b3a482ab571c63d86133d49a3f691f OP_EQUAL
- address
- 3DLn5t7bg9FxY69gKPEpGcUfLq6YttjnWb